The process felt long and hard from the outset. After the initial stages, the technical questions required real hands-on product experience. I could not have relied on generic product language to answer them confidently or accurately.
The challenge was also organizing my thinking under pressure while remaining precise. Follow-up questions kept probing until I connected my reasoning to real-world experience. I did not receive an offer. Looking back, practical depth rather than interview fluency was what separated me from the role’s standard.
